Italy petrol tops €2.6: opposition and groups sound alarm, govt weighs variable fuel duty
Fuel costs are back in the spotlight: in Milan and on motorways prices exceed €2.60 a litre. Opposition parties and associations warn of hikes hitting families and firms, while the Meloni government drafts measures to stem the crisis.
